You can start a new company in India in just two days by getting online permissions: Shaktikanta Das to China

New Delhi, Feb 13 (KNN) Many procedures have been simplified in India to improve Ease of Doing Business environment, Economic Affairs Secretary Shaktikanta Das adding that a new company can be started in just two days by getting online permissions.

Das met delegation of Chinese media persons in the national capital today.

He said, “We are focusing on transferring subsidies directly to the bank account of the beneficiary through DBT. DBT is to ensure that benefit reaches the poor directly and there is no scope of leakage.”

The Economic Affairs Secretary said many procedures have been simplified to improve ease of doing business environment in the country and the clearances are being given very quickly now.

“Now in India, you can start a new company in just two days by getting online permissions,” he said.

Stressing that India values its economic ties with China, Das said Chinese President during his visit to India in 2104, had announced USD 20 billion investment in India which has started flowing now.

He said India is looking at more investment inflow from China and the Embassy is working closely with China for this.

Highlighting the huge trade deficit that India has with China, Das said, “For sustainable trade relationship, balance of trade is required between India & China.”

Total trade between India and China in 2016 was USD 71 billion. India had a very wide trade deficit of $46 billion in this.

India is very strong in IT software and Pharma and would like to export these to China along with fruits, fish & vegetables, said Das.

He sought greater market access to China for India.

On GST, he said China had showed a lot of interest in India’s GST. GST will improve business environment and GDP growth. (KNN Bureau)
